Louisiana's state capital sits on the first genuine bluff above the Mississippi delta, a topographic anomaly that gave it strategic value and now gives it a slightly varied landscape compared to the flatlands south and west. BREC operates four golf courses within East Baton Rouge Parish — City Park, J.S. Clark, Santa Maria, and Webb Park — representing a sustained municipal commitment to affordable golf across the city's geography. The university presence of LSU gives Baton Rouge a younger energy, while state government and petrochemical industry anchor its economy. The courses range from tree-lined parkland to more open layouts, each serving different neighborhoods and playing skill levels. Summers are heavy with heat and humidity; winters rarely interrupt play for more than a few days.
